Packed with the power of a Quad-core processor, Android Jellybean and an IPS multi-touch screen for better viewing angles, the new 10.1 inch Lenovo tablet is designed to deliver an immersive and true-to-life multimedia experience. It also features expandable storage, front and rear facing cameras and micro-HDMI port to connect to a big-screen TV or monitor. Model number: S6000. With 16GB built-in and a MicroSD card slot you have the flexibility and convenience of up to 32GB extra storage space (MicroSD Card not included). Front-facing webcam for video chats and rear-facing camera with LED flash and 30 fps video recording. With Android 4.2 JellyBean you can access all your favourite entertainment and productivity apps through the Google Play Store. A vibrant, wide-view 10.1 IPS display with 10-point multi-touch provides precise control as well as a vivid and immersive viewing experience. The S6000's Micro-HDMI port also allows you to send HD video and audio to your big-screen TV. Micro-USB-on-the-go enable you to reverse the normal micro-USB connection from the tablet to another device, so your tablet can charge your phone or MP3 player while you can also utilize data on an external USB drive. Display: 10.1 inch screen. Resolution 1280 x 800 pixels. IPS technology. Multi-touch screen. Specifications: 1.2GHz quad core processor. 1GB RAM. 16 GB internal storage. Android 4.2 Jelly Bean operating system. General features: Built-in speaker. Front camera. Wi-Fi enabled. Bluetooth - enabling you to easily and wirelessly connect with other bluetooth enabled devices. Mini HDMI. Micro USB. Additional information: Up to 9 hours battery life (depending on usage). 8.6mm thin. Size H26, W18cm. Weight 560g. EAN: 0887770323009.
